Types of Replacement Cushions for Outdoor Furniture

Deep Seating Replacement Cushions

Deep seating cushions are thick, plush, and specifically designed for outdoor sofas, loveseats, and lounge chairs. They offer superior comfort and are usually 5 to 7 inches thick. This category is especially popular for luxury and modern patio sets.

When choosing deep seating cushions, look for high-density foam or layered foam-and-fiber blends. These provide long-term support and retain shape better than cheaper alternatives. Ensure the fabric is UV-resistant, water-resistant, and durable enough for year-round outdoor use.

Replacement Cushions for Outdoor Wicker Furniture

Wicker furniture—both natural and resin-based—requires cushions shaped to fit curved or woven frames. You’ll find many replacement cushions designed specifically for wicker pieces, including rounded seat cushions and tufted backs.

When choosing cushions for wicker furniture, make sure they have ties or Velcro straps to secure them. Wicker tends to shift and move, so fasteners help keep cushions in place even on windy days. Fabric breathability is also important, since wicker traps moisture if the cushion isn’t designed properly.

Best Fabrics for Outdoor Replacement Cushions

Choosing the right fabric is crucial for longevity. Outdoor cushions must handle rain, sun, stains, and constant use.

Sunbrella Fabric

Sunbrella is widely considered the top-tier outdoor fabric. It is highly resistant to UV rays, stains, mold, and mildew. Sunbrella cushions can last up to 10 years with proper care, making them the best long-term investment.

These cushions come in a massive range of colors, textures, and patterns. They’re more expensive but save money over time due to their long lifespan and superior durability.

Polyester Fabric

Polyester is the most common and budget-friendly option. You’ll find thousands of polyester cushion sets on Amazon, Walmart, Home Depot, and similar stores.

They’re great for short-term or seasonal use. However, polyester does fade faster than Sunbrella and may wear out after a year or two of heavy exposure to sunlight.

Olefin Fabric

Olefin is becoming increasingly popular for outdoor cushions. It offers excellent UV resistance, good water protection, and long-lasting durability at a more affordable price than Sunbrella.

This fabric resists fading, drying out, and fraying, making it one of the best mid-range options.

Top Features to Look For in Replacement Cushions

To ensure your new cushions last and stay comfortable, look for:

Weather Resistance

Outdoor cushions must handle:

Rain

Harsh sunlight

Humidity

Mold

Mildew

Choose cushions with waterproof liners, quick-dry foam, and fade-resistant fabrics.

Comfort Level

Foam quality makes a huge difference. High-density foam or memory foam blends provide the best comfort and support. Avoid cheap polyfill-only cushions, as they flatten quickly.

Durability

Look for double-stitched seams, strong zippers, premium filling, and heavy-duty fabric. This ensures your cushions survive outdoor conditions for multiple seasons.

How to Measure Your Furniture for Replacement Cushions

Before buying, always measure:

Seat width

Seat depth

Back height

Cushion thickness

Accurate measurements prevent returns and ensure a perfect fit. Use a measuring tape and measure from seam to seam or inside edge to inside edge.

How Long Outdoor Cushions Last

The lifespan of outdoor cushions depends heavily on the fabric type and exposure conditions.

Polyester cushions typically last 1 to 3 years.

Olefin cushions last 3 to 5 years.

Sunbrella cushions last 7 to 10 years or more.

Proper care can extend their lifespan significantly.
